Team

The Credit Infrastructure team within Integrated Risk Management builds and maintains batch engines for the Risk domain. These engines compute rule-based parameters, such as definition of default and early warning signals, as well as model-based parameters such as Probability of Default (PD) and Loss Given Default (LGD).

The engines must comply with regulations because the computed parameters have a major impact on capital calculations, risk-weighted assets (RWA), and loan loss provisions (LLP). The team also maintains the data mart used for developing new models and acts as a vital link between the credit risk business and operational tribes such as data management.
